why does this shortcut get created on startmenu everytime i launch it from quicklaunch menu?


Author:  Jcee [ Tue Mar 12, 2019 12:23 pm ]
Post subject:  Re: why does this shortcut get created automatically?

the app itself is likely creating the shortcut in the start menu folder for windows.
Right click the start button go to settings
search 'pinned'
and select 'use pinned folder'
Hopefully that solves it.

Author:  Jcee [ Sat Mar 16, 2019 11:50 am ]
Post subject:  Re: why does this shortcut get created automatically?

then your options are very limited
A: go to classic shell, and remove the 'programs folder' creating a new folder then copy all the contents of the programs folder and paste them in this new folder. This new folder will appear the same, however any new apps will no-longer have their shortcuts added to the start menu
B: uninstall the app
C: ignore the shortcut
D: write a script/program that automatically removes the shortcut whenever its created
